The election will be valid even if Lok Sabha and all Legislative Assemblies are dissolved and only elected members of Rajya Sabha vote in the election. Nominated members of Rajya Sabha, Lok Sabha and Legislative Assemblies do not have the right to vote in presidential election.

The constitution prescribes that to be President the person has to be a citizen of India, completed the age of 35 years, qualified for election as member of Lok Sabha and should not hold any office of profit.
